Renee Miller work experience
A career timeline built from the work history available for this profile.
Role listed
Project Manager
Black Belt Manager
Leading high impact continuous improvement projects aligned with company and division strategic priorities, to include developing a quality improvement roadmap for chemical plants in division to implement as well as a second project to establish standardized and consistent tier meetings within the chemical plants to achieve sustainability goals. Teach, mentor and coach Green Belts using Lean Six Sigma methodology.
Operations Manager
Led the Operations team consisting of 2 focus factories, Warehouse and Logistics, and Lean and Admindepartments through building the teams, establishing the priorities, and removing roadblocks for safetyperformance, durable compliance, efficiency, and continuous growth. Responsible for 24/7 operations, 10 salaried direct reports, 16 shift supervisors, and 350 hourly employees. Championed the site through a 5S revolution using coaching, dedicated support with standard work, and re-invigorating the Tier 1s. Strategically grew the operations team with focus on leadership and personal development at all levels. Mitigated impact of COVID challenges through education, preparedness, and auditing.
Site Deployment/Continuous Improvement Manager
Continuous Improvement Manager (11/18-09/19). Managed 10 cross-functional subject matter experts, using Lean and Six Sigma practices to improve safety, performance, and customer service. Implemented Daily Management System (DMS) while incorporating Process Based Leadership and Shingo Principle models. Redesigned Tier meetings with coaching to drive employee engagement. As site lead for pilot plant of 3M Execution model, conducted experiments in DMS, Coaching, and Standard Work. Coached operations team.Site Deployment Manager (09/18-11/18): Managed team of 12 cross-functional subject matter experts through preparations and change impact projects for ERP transition. Project placed on hold 11/2018.
Supply Chain Manager
Managed Supply Chain and Logistics team, 20 direct reports, set the Supply Chain strategic direction and aligned resources to meet site EHSR, service, capacity, quality, cost, and productivity metrics. Improved team performance with standardizing processes and control plans along with extensive effort hiring 12 employees to restructure and staff up the team. Redefined “Win the Day” approach for customer service, order backlog, and inventory levels. Continuous improvement and lean focus, executing on cash and inventory reduction projects.
Production Manager
Led Aluminum finishing plant, directing daily activities, and coordinating through support functions to maximize safe production with high quality levels while operating within planned budget. Responsible for plant performance and P&L, reporting to Director of Operations. Oversees 24/7 operations with 1 superintendent, 4 supervisors, and 75 personnel. Launched "Admin Cell" initiative- a central workspace and daily meeting cadence for cross-functional teams to work towards common goals. Implemented daily Leader Standard Work for production manager and shift supervisors. Launched start of shift meetings for improved communication and daily coordination of plan from supervisors to crew as well as a platform to introduce daily stretching program. Implemented 6S at a pilot work center to include tool storage, sustained operator ownership, and auditing.
Operations Superintendent / Supervisor
Managed the daily manufacturing operations of a three shift flexible packaging department (4 shift supervisors, 67 personnel). Interim responsibility for department performance in safety, quality, delivery, and P&L during plant implementation of IL6S. Assumed role of a nighttime superintendent August 2015, responsible for entire packaging plant production and sanitation during third shift. Coached all employees on individual work plans using IL6S approach. Launched Ergonomic Team, using Humantech approach, conducted assessments for high-risk tasks. (3+ yrs). Commercialized multiple new SKUs, downsized packaging materials to harmonize shipper and caddy size, and transitioned entire SKU line of film to new preferred vendor.
Operations Supervisor
Oversaw the daily manufacturing operations in the Bologna Slice Pak Department (100 personnel) and Lunchables Department (200 personnel). Directed production, maintenance, and quality assurance while maintaining personal safety and product quality levels with focus on continuous improvement using Lean/6 Sigma. Used Root Cause Analysis training to develop a thorough method for investigating and documenting acute and recordable injuries in manufacturing plant. Plant Ergonomic Team leader for 3 years, accountable for maintaining plant-wide training and awareness, conducted ergonomic worksite assessments for specific jobs and new line installs. Led 2 Safety Strategy teams to develop and implement sustainable improvements to the manufacturing workplace by increasing safety awareness using 5S and team developed training.
Training Officer, Fleet Training Center
Reported directly to the Commanding Officer for all matters concerning divisional personnel and equipment. Professionally developed subordinates to full potential, continuously monitoring daily performances, and formally documenting positive and negative counseling.Training Officer at Naval Fleet Training Command, managed 20 instructors through revolutionary changes in the Navy training regime, eliminating redundant work and maximizing training efficiency. Trained, mentored and developed entry level Navy Enlisted personnel on Navy rules, regulations and traditions. Prepared a comprehensive presentation documenting changes in the Navy training structure for 500+ personnel. Presentation was praised for high-quality and used to train incoming personnel.
Ship'S Navigator, Uss Ramage
Supervised 30 personnel in safe navigation, voyage planning, and deployment transiting as the Ship’s Navigator. Provided realistic, flexible solutions for the Navy’s ever changing operational requirements, including certification on both paper and electronic navigation charts.
Main Propulsion Officer, Uss Ramage
Supervised 40 personnel in the maintenance, repairs, and operation of a U.S. Navy Destroyer propulsion plant. As Engineering Officer of the Watch operated the engineering plant, responded to equipment casualties, and restored plant capability during underway naval operations. Inspected engineering plant repairs and maintenance as the Quality Assurance Officer, verifying compliance with naval regulations and technical manuals. Inspected work environment and maintenance duties for compliance with safety regulations and operating procedures.
